Did Zhao Lusi's C-drama rival Esther Yu's agency try to ruin her career with a fake seal sneak campaign? Here's what we know

Zhao Lusi found herself at the center of one of China's biggest celebrity scandals when allegations erupted that she had forged a government seal and falsely claimed the title of "ambassador supporting farmers." The controversy, which drew in nearly 200 million netizens, quickly took a darker turn as whispers pointed toward Esther Yu - Zhao's long-rumoured rival - with many suspecting the smear campaign was orchestrated to tarnish her name. The rivalry between Zhao Lusi and Esther Yu has been a constant point of comparison in the entertainment industry, as both are part of the post-95 generation of rising stars who made their mark through hit historical and romantic dramas. But within just 24 hours, the storm shifted. Authorities confirmed that the seal was authentic, clearing Zhao of wrongdoing. What initially seemed like a career-ending scandal began to unravel as something far more sinister: a deliberate attempt to destroy her reputation. Esther Yu's shadow looms large At the heart of the conspiracy talk was Qianjiang Video, the outlet that fanned the flames with a viral video accusing Zhao of fraud. The company has ties to Yuehua Entertainment, Esther Yu's agency, and a history of posting negative coverage about Zhao while relentlessly promoting Yu, even during her weaker projects. For many, it was no coincidence. Forced into silence Despite her attempts to clarify that the "ambassador" title belonged to her company, not herself, Zhao was drowned under a tidal wave of online hate. On August 13, she permanently deleted her Weibo account - a shocking move fans saw as proof that her rivals had succeeded, at least in silencing her voice. That's so embarrassing😭 The backlash backfires Then came the reversal. Mainstream Chinese media and farmers from Shaanxi province - the very farmers Zhao had promoted - defended her integrity. Farmers verified that their crops had suffered hail damage and low sales, and they praised Zhao for increasing visibility. Netizens switched abruptly, debating whether Zhao was the villain or the victim of a merciless industrial takedown. While risks remain due to her management disputes, Zhao Lusi now stands in the public eye as both survivor and scapegoat, with many seeing her as a celebrity who endured sabotage for doing good. But the result is clear: Zhao Lusi's rivalry with Esther Yu has now turned into open conflict, and this scandal might just be the start of an even bigger fight between the two stars.

Esther Yu and management part ways amicably

7 Aug - Huace Film & TV has recently dismissed the notion of a contract termination issue between them and their artiste Esther Yu (aka Yu Shuxin), after she removed her business contact email from her Weibo bio. Admitting that they have parted ways, the company clarified that it was an amicable separation after the contract expired. "The contract expired and the collaboration ended at the end of 2024. It was not a contract termination. Esther and the company have been together for eight years, growing side by side. We wish her all the best in the future!" the company stated. Esther began her collaboration with Huace in 2017, signing a seven-year contract. Due to the success of "Love Between Fairy and Devil", the contract was briefly extended. Both parties chose not to renew following the end of the contract. The amicable end received praise from netizens, amid the conflict between Zhao Lusi and her management, Yinhekuyu Media. Esther Yu's camp asks fans to calm down over rude behaviour

31 Jul - Esther Yu's management recently found themselves having to release a statement reminding her fans to remain rational, following several instances of their unruly behaviour online. The whole issue sparked after Esther's fans lashed out at her studio, accusing it of being "negligent" in managing her career, and focused their rage especially on her manager Li Jing. They claimed that her studio has failed to secure top-tier opportunities like global endorsement deals. In one instance, her fans even went to the social media account of Esther's sponsored watch brand to call her the "first Chinese spokesperson" of the brand, only to be corrected by others who pointed out that the late actress Barbie Hsu was actually the first. Angered by the fact-check, some of these fans left rude comments like, "Why mention her when she is already dead?", sparking anger among many. As the situation escalated, Esther's studio released a statement on Weibo, stating that they have read all the concerns, and that they have the same goal as the fans. "We will strive to secure the resources that she deserves and increase the number of liaisons as soon as possible to expedite the process," her management said. At the same time, they remind fans to remain rational, stating that fans' extreme behaviour online may violate the law. (Photo Source: Esther IG, Meteor Garden Fanpage IG)
